Prosecution appeals Laville-verdict
Loading...

St.maarten – The prosecutor’s office has filed appeals against the verdicts in the so-called Zeepaard (Seahorse) and Sardine-investigations. Former Member of Parliament Romain Laville was acquitted on August 24 of making threats against the lives of former MP Jules James and steel pan icon Isidore York. The court sentenced Laville however to a 1-month suspended prison sentence for illegal firearm possession, though the considerations of the court made clear that it held Laville more responsible for an administrative oversight related to the extension of his gun permit than for the gun itself.
